Latest Patents

Among his latest patents, Deppe has developed a process using an integrated system to continuously inject small amounts of immiscible liquid. This process involves injecting an immiscible liquid stream that comprises a co-catalyst for hydrocarbon conversion into a larger liquid stream, which serves as an ionic liquid catalyst for the hydrocarbon conversion.
